Eligibility

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: All individuals above 18 years of age having histopathologically proven, recurrent and/or metastatic triple negative breast cancer (mTNBC) during the period of January 2015 to June 2022. Patients could have received any number of lines of treatment in the metastatic and/or recurrent setting.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Patients with breast cancer without triple negative disease.

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
To assess the treatment pattern and outcomes in patients with recurrent unresectable and/or metastatic triple negative breast cancers.Timepoint: 24 months

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
To assess the clinical and radiological profile in patients with metastatic TNBC.Timepoint: 24 months;To assess the patterns of treatment used in the management of recurrent and/or metastatic TNBC.Timepoint: 24 months;To assess the toxicity of treatment in included patients.Timepoint: 24 months;To evaluate the OS in patients with recurrent and/or metastatic TNBC who are treated at the Tata Memorial Hospital and/or ACTREC during the study period.Timepoint: 24 months;To evaluate the PFS in patients with recurrent and/or metastatic TNBC who receive chemotherapy and/or Immunotherapy Targeted therapy during the mentioned study period at the Tata Memorial Hospital and/or ACTREC.Timepoint: 24 months
